Message type: E = Error
Message class: COM_PRODUCT - General Messages on Products
Message number: 303
Message text: Could not determine status

- Could not determine status ?The SAP error message COM_PRODUCT303: Could not determine status typically occurs in the context of product management or logistics within the SAP system. This error indicates that the system is unable to determine the status of a product, which can be due to various reasons. Here are some common causes, potential solutions, and related information:
Causes:
- Missing Master Data: The product master data may not be fully maintained or could be missing essential information.
- Incorrect Configuration: There may be issues with the configuration settings related to product status determination.
- Data Inconsistencies: There could be inconsistencies in the data, such as missing links between product and status records.
- Authorization Issues: The user may not have the necessary authorizations to access the product status information.
- System Errors: There could be temporary system errors or issues with the database that prevent the status from being determined.
Solutions:
- Check Product Master Data: Ensure that all relevant fields in the product master data are filled out correctly. This includes checking for any missing or incorrect entries.
- Review Configuration Settings: Verify the configuration settings related to product status determination in the relevant customizing transactions (e.g., SPRO).
- Data Consistency Check: Run data consistency checks to identify and resolve any inconsistencies in the product and status records.
- User Authorizations: Check the user roles and authorizations to ensure that the user has the necessary permissions to view product statuses.
- System Logs: Review system logs (transaction SLG1) for any additional error messages or warnings that could provide more context about the issue.
- Consult SAP Notes: Search for relevant SAP Notes in the SAP Support Portal that may address this specific error message or provide patches/updates.
- Contact SAP Support: If the issue persists, consider reaching out to SAP Support for further assistance, providing them with detailed information about the error and the context in which it occurs.
